Output 500c81b80f2813d0d6616d0e6e4786a39da1cb109fc74adb7ead7fa01120c96d:1

value
70253
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25eefecb67a8f519874fceea4fe24a7589be8e2f OP_EQUAL
address
359bEKpzxLsVEir8mAjXaKDHfRzccUgbqt
transaction
500c81b80f2813d0d6616d0e6e4786a39da1cb109fc74adb7ead7fa01120c96d
spent
true